Passive sacrifice is a tactical concept: the sacrifice of a piece, by moving a different piece, leaving the sacrificed piece under attack. Do not stop at naming the motif; calculate the forcing line that makes it work.
What to look for on the board
- Checks, captures, and threats.
- Loose pieces and unsafe kings.
- A forcing sequence, not just a pattern name.
